failed - ssl python 3 example
zsh: no se encontraron coincidencias: solicitudes (1)
Estoy tratando de ejecutar un script urllib2 de python y obtengo este error:
InsecurePlatformWarning: un verdadero objeto SSLContext no está disponible. Esto evita que urllib3 configure SSL adecuadamente y puede causar que ciertas conexiones SSL fallen. Para obtener más información, consulte https://urllib3.readthedocs.org/en/latest/security.html#insecureplatformwarning .
Después de buscar en Google el error, la solución, en el desbordamiento de pila es descargar el paquete de seguridad de las solicitudes:
pip install requests[security]
Pero cuando corro me sale el error ...
zsh: no se encontraron coincidencias: solicitudes [seguridad]
Alguien sabe por qué zsh no está recogiendo esta biblioteca, instala / actualiza las solicitudes muy bien, no sé por qué esto no funciona
Estoy ejecutando esto en un servidor Debian ...
zsh
utiliza corchetes para la combinación de globos / patrones .
Eso significa que si necesita pasar los corchetes literales como un argumento a un comando, necesita escapar de ellos o citar el argumento de esta manera:
pip install ''requests[security]''
Si desea deshabilitar la globbing para el comando pip
permanente, puede hacerlo agregando esto a su ~/.zshrc
:
alias pip=''noglob pip''